In a true labour of love, Jaco and Vanessa Fourie blended their professional skills with their passion for animals to turn a dull space into the cosiest cat room for CLAW.

 

Johannesburg, South Africa (16 April 2026) – A few furry felines are about to enjoy the best naps and snuggles of their lives, thanks to the kindness of Vanessa and Jaco Fourie. This dedicated husband-and-wife duo recently chose to give back to Community Led Animal Welfare (CLAW) in the cosiest way imaginable: by designing and building a brand-new cat room from scratch.

“There was a lot of preparation work involved as they had to strip old tiles and window panes, along with making the room clean, secure and free from hazards,” CLAW explained.

But the Fouris were up for the task, working their magic from the not-so-fun prep work to breathing a new and vibrant life into the space to create comfortable sleep space, play shelves and scratch columns.

An area that was previously drab and unsuitable has now been renovated to be cheerful and fun!

“The structures were all built by Jaco, and soft furnishings were made by Vanessa.  A massive thank you to Vanessa and Jaco for doing this for our cats, we are so grateful,” CLAW said.

CLAW works to provide desperately needed veterinary services to dogs and cats, as well as vital animal care education to pet owners in Johannesburg’s poorest township areas. Through their hard work and generosity, Vanessa and Jaco have provided more than just a renovation; they’ve provided a bridge to a better life. As these cats wait for their forever homes, they now have a beautiful, dignified space to play and rest.
